Greystones Primary School, based in Sheffield, provides primary education, serving pupils aged 4 to 11. The school is a community school and operates as a mixed school. It follows a not applicable admissions policy. It does not have a designated religious character, which may suit families looking for a non-faith school.
Greystones Primary School currently has around 627 pupils on roll, which is about 100% of its capacity. The gender split is relatively balanced, with approximately 51% boys and 49% girls. Around 7.8%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, which gives an indication of the socio-economic mix. The student population reflects a mixed community across different backgrounds and needs.
Overall absence at the school is 4.2%. Persistent absence is recorded at 9.5%. The school also includes resourced provision, supporting 12 pupils.
The majority of pupils are from a white british background (70.8%).
At its latest Ofsted inspection, the school was rated Good. This suggests the school is performing well overall. Safeguarding was judged to be effective, which is a key consideration for many parents.
